When you hear the words “jar games,” your mind might immediately jump to the county fair—specifically, that jar full of jellybeans where you have to guess the exact number to win a giant teddy bear. But jar games are so much more than a carnival staple. From ancient divination rituals to modern-day party icebreakers, the simple glass (or plastic) jar is a powerhouse of portable, low-cost fun.
